What is a seminar

The Association is the UK’s leading provider of postgraduate education for all pathways into Anaesthesia. The Association’s seminar programme features leading experts in anaesthesia, critical care and pain medicine presenting the latest information and thinking on a variety of key anaesthesia topics. Our seminars are designed to focus on a specific field of interest within anaesthesia and help to build on specialist interests. They offer an intimate learning environment, with a maximum of 45 delegates attending each. Keeping the numbers low encourages delegate and faculty interaction.

About this seminar

This one-day interactive workshop focuses on career reflection and development for senior clinicians. It offers the opportunity to come away from the workplace and reflect and plan for the next stage of your career. We explore the challenges faced by senior clinicians, and take stock of current skills, knowledge and strengths with respect to your role. We use simple coaching models for peer-coaching, as well as using well-established career tools/exercises to aid reflection and planning. Most importantly the workshop provides you with the time and space to think creatively about the next stage of your career. We haven’t been specific on what we mean by ‘senior clinician’, but if you’ve been in your substantive role as a consultant or Specialty/SAS  doctor for five years or more, this course is for you. This workshop has been run in many locations across the UK, with excellent feedback from delegates that it provides an excellent opportunity for individuals to plan intentionally for the next chapter of their life and career. 

Organiser: Dr Lois Brand

Intended audience

Aimed at Consultant anaesthetists, SAS anaesthetists / Specialty anaesthetists.

Learning objectives

  • Time out to think and reflect creatively about your career and your plans going forward.
  • Take stock of what’s currently working well and not so well for you within your career. 
  • Identify and plan for key areas of development over the next few years.
  • Learn new techniques to support ongoing career/professional/personal development.
  • Share ideas that support career longevity and fulfilment with colleagues from across the UK.
